XML-based Dynamic Service Behaviour Representation
نویسنده
چکیده
This paper presents an XML-based framework for implementation language and platform independent service execution behaviour representation. It is based on an FSMinterpreter which can interpret and execute XML-represented FSM behaviour. This model has been integrated into TAPAS (Telematics Architecture for Plug-and-Play Systems) platform. TAPAS has basically two engineering viewpoint functionality classes: i) Dynamic service configuration and ii) Dynamic service instantiation. The dynamic service configuration is already based on XML. Using XML for the service execution representation gives one integrated representation of all dynamic service related functionality. As XML basically is a structure representation language, dynamic behaviour representation is made possible by utilising the inherent characteristics of the TAPAS basic architecture. TAPAS defines the behaviour by plugandplay manuscripts and Node inherent capabilities.
منابع مشابه
Semantically Annotating Reactive Services with Temporal Specifications
Most useful Web services are reactive systems that repeatedly act and react in interaction with their environment without necessarily terminating. Current Standards (XML based/Ontologies) for specifying behavioural semantics of services consider transformational aspects of service behaviour. Specification of reactive Web services require representation of properties that are temporal in nature....
متن کاملBehaviour Analysis And Verification of Web Service Compositions
This work describes an approach of a set of techniques and tools for analysing web service compositions and interactions amongst groups of web service compositions. As web technology has evolved, an emphasis has been placed on providing ease of design and deployment, with WYSIWYG now the normal rather than the exception for rapidly building web served applications. This is equally applicable to...
متن کاملAVANTE: An architecture of CORBA components and XML Metadata for Web Based Instructions
Most current solutions for Web Based Instruction (WBI) use a centralized management model and a proprietary internal representation. The AVANTE Architecture is a WBI environment assembled using CORBA distributed components, implementing core services such as course management, user authentication, collaborative work, database access, presentation, and others. The AVANTE components conform to a ...
متن کاملFinite State Automata as Conceptual Model for E-Services
Recently, a plethora of languages for modeling and specifying different facets of e-Services have been proposed, and some of them provides constructs for representing time. Time is needed in many contexts to correctly capture the dynamics of transactions and of composability between e-Services. However, to the best of our knowledge, all the proposed languages for representing e-Service behaviou...
متن کاملToward Remote Object Coherence with Compiled Object Serialization for Distributed Computing with XML Web Services
Cross-platform object-level coherence in Web services-based distributed systems and grids requires lossless serialization to ensure programming-language specific objects are safely transmitted, manipulated, and stored. However, Web services development tools often suffer from lossy forms of XML serialization, which diminishes the usefulness of XML Web services as a competitive approach to binar...
متن کامل